Font Pairing Strategies for Cohesive Design
One common mistake small business owners make is using only one font everywhere. While Selectify is striking, it should primarily serve as a display font or headline typeface. To maintain readability and hierarchy, it needs to be paired with a simpler supporting typeface.
A classic and effective strategy is to pair Selectify with a clean sans serif font. The geometric simplicity of a sans serif balances the ornate nature of the stencil serif, creating a modern contrast. Use Selectify for your main headings, logos, and short impactful phrases, then switch to your sans serif for body text, descriptions, and contact information. This ensures that while your brand looks stylish, it remains easy to read.
Alternatively, if you want a softer, more editorial look, you might pair it with a light-weight serif font. However, avoid pairing it with other decorative fonts like script or handwritten fonts unless you have advanced design skills. Too many competing styles can create visual noise that confuses your customers.
Readability Across Different Mediums
As a business owner, you need to ensure your chosen font works in all contexts. Test Selectify at various sizes. Does it remain legible on a tiny product sticker? Is it clear on a dark background in a Facebook ad? Stencil fonts can sometimes lose detail when scaled down too much. Always print proofs or view designs on actual devices before finalizing your brand assets. If the fine details disappear on a mobile screen, consider simplifying the layout or increasing the font size.

Important Licensing Considerations
Before you start slapping Selectify on every product you sell, please take a moment to review the licensing terms. As an entrepreneur, protecting your business legally is paramount. Ensure you have purchased the appropriate commercial license. Using a font for personal projects is different from using it for merchandise, packaging, or client deliverables. Check whether the license covers digital downloads, print runs, and physical goods. Respecting intellectual property not only keeps you compliant but also supports the designers who create these valuable assets.
